Information Technology Officer (Development) (Non-Civil Service Vacancy)

Starting Salary Range: HK$44,700 - $47,700 per month, depending on qualifications and experience

Entry Requirements:

(a) Candidates [See Note (1)] should have –

  1. a b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Information Technology (IT) or related discipline from a university in Hong Kong, or equivalent;
  2. met the language proficiency requirements of 'Level 2' [See Note (2)] or above in Chinese Language and English Language in the Hong Kong Diploma of Secondary Education Examination (HKDSEE) or the Hong Kong Certificate of Education Examination (HKCEE), or equivalent;
  3. at least four (4) years relevant post-qualification full-time IT working experience of which two (2) years must be in a similar post and in a comparable capacity; and
  4. at least two (2) years full-time hands-on experience in system development life cycle (SDLC) in Java-based systems (with Java frameworks such as Spring MVC, Spring Boot, etc. adopted), including feasibility study, system analysis and design, procurement and installation, programming and implementation, system nursing and maintenance.
(b) Candidates should be customer-oriented and able to perform under pressure, willing to work after office hours and occasionally working on an on-call basis as required.

(c) Preference will be given to candidates who have experience in using the following technologies/products:

  1. Agile software development;
  2. Continuous Integration/Continuous Delivery (CI/CD) pipeline;
  3. DevSecOps;
  4. Full stack development (MEAN/MERN);
  5. RESTful API development;
  6. Python programming;
  7. NoSQL database;
  8. Containerisation such as Red Hat OpenShift, podman, containerd, KubeSphere, Knative, etc.; and
  9. Service mesh/serverless architecture.

Duties:

Information Technology Officer (Development) will be mainly responsible for –

  1. performing in-house development with full SDLC and documentation;
  2. providing on-going support such as troubleshooting and bug fixing for various systems and applications;
  3. handling website updating and web hosting management;
  4. providing technical advices to support business requirements;
  5. engaging and collaborating with stakeholders to meet the business objectives; and
  6. carrying out other technical and administrative duties as specified by the management.
